In light weight panelized roof configurations, Purlins spacing is defined as which of the following?

Explanation:
In light-weight panelized roof systems, purlins are the secondary members that the roof panels tie into, carrying the panel loads and transferring them to the main framing. The spacing is chosen to provide solid edge support for the panels, keep deflection low, and align with typical panel widths and fastening patterns. Eight feet on center is the standard because it gives enough support along the length of the panels to prevent sagging and to provide reliable nailing or screw points, while still keeping materials and labor economical. Why the other options aren’t the right fit: those describe spacing for different components or use a spacing that would leave the panels insufficiently supported. Beams spacing refers to the primary structural members, not purlins. Ceiling joists pertain to interior ceiling framing, not roof panel support. A twelve-foot on-center purlin spacing would create longer spans between supports, increasing the risk of deflection and inadequate panel backing, which is why eight feet on center is preferred.
